Hyperliquid, the popular perpetual DEX platform, has unveiled a lobby group ahead of the U.S elections.
In a statement, the lobby, Hyperliquid Policy Center (HPC), said that it seeks to “answer toughest policy questions facing perpetual derivatives and decentralized financial (DeFi) markets.”

The project said it will unstake 1 million HYPE tokens to fund the advocacy outfit. As of the press time, that would translate to approximately $29 million.
Long-time pro-cryptocurrency lawyer and DeFi advocate, Jake Chervinsky, will lead HPC.
According to the project, the move could help set a smooth path forward and cover the regulatory risks from U.S regulators.

Hyperliquid has been live for about three years now. However, it is already outpacing incumbents like Binance and Coinbase on crypto perpetual markets and other metrics.
In fact, the platform has expanded to non-crypto assets that now account for over 30% of its overall trading volume.
With a cumulative revenue of over $1 billion and nearly $4 trillion in perpetual volumes, Hyperliquid has clearly become a crypto success story.

But beneath the growth story, there’s been speculation that most traders on the platform could be running a regulatory arbitrage for tax evasion or even bypassing sanctions.
For critics, these allegations could be a regulatory risk for Hyperliquid if the Department of Justice (DoJ) or the U.S Treasury comes knocking. In fact, Hyperliquid supporters agreed that the platform’s growth could be derailed either by the DoJ probe or a security breach.
Besides, the market is pricing an increasing chance of Democrats retaking control of Congress in the 2026 midterms.
If so, the previous anti-crypto movement may resurface and exacerbate Hyperliquid’s regulatory risk. And to some extent, this may partially explain the recent lobby move.
